- Tree Pruning - needed to remove dead or diseased branches to promote tree health and safety.
- Structural Pruning - required to shape young trees or correct weak branch unions for long-term stability.
- Thinning - performed to reduce canopy density and improve light penetration and air circulation.
- Emergency Pruning - necessary after storms or storm damage to prevent falling branches or further hazards.
- Fruit Tree Pruning - essential for maximizing fruit production and maintaining tree vigor.
Arborist p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ping trees to promote their health and appearance. Skilled service providers use specialized techniques to remove dead or diseased branches, reduce overcrowding, and maintain proper structural integrity. Regular pruning can help prevent potential hazards caused by falling limbs or weak tree parts, ensuring that trees remain safe and stable over time. This service is essential for maintaining the overall vitality of trees and enhancing the visual appeal of a property.
Many common problems can be addressed through professional pruning. Overgrown branches can obstruct walkways, driveways, or windows, creating safety concerns or reducing natural light. Diseased or damaged limbs can compromise the health of a tree if not removed promptly. Additionally, trees that have become misshapen or unbalanced may need pruning to restore their natural form. Proper trimming also encourages new growth and can extend the lifespan of mature trees, making it a practical solution for homeowners dealing with these issues.

The overview below groups typical Arborist Pruning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Pruning Jobs - typical costs range from $150 to $600 for routine pruning of smaller trees and shrubs. Many standard maintenance projects fall within this range, making it an affordable option for regular upkeep.
Medium-Sized Tree Pruning - these projects usually cost between $600 and $1,500, depending on tree size and complexity. Many local contractors handle these jobs regularly within this middle range.
Larger or Complex Pruning - more involved pruning of large trees or difficult access jobs can range from $1,500 to $3,000 or more. Fewer projects push into this higher tier, which often involves specialized equipment or safety measures.
Full Tree Removal or Major Overhaul - extensive work like complete tree removal or significant pruning can reach $3,000 to $5,000+ in some cases. These larger projects are less common and typically involve detailed planning and specialized crews.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
